Hadith text

Original Arabic

حَدَّثَنَا عَفَّانُ، حَدَّثَنَا وُهَيْبٌ، حَدَّثَنَا مُوسَى بْنُ عُقْبَةَ، قَالَ: حَدَّثَنِي مُحَمَّدُ بْنُ يَحْيَى بْنِ حَبَّانَ، عَنِ ابْنِ مُحَيْرِيزٍ، عَنْ أَبِي سَعِيدٍ الْخُدْرِيِّ فِي غَزْوَةِ بَنِي الْمُصْطَلِقِ، أَنَّهُمْ أَصَابُوا، ، سَبَايَا، فَأَرَادُوا أَنْ يَسْتَمْتِعُوا بِهِنَّ، وَلَا يَحْمِلْنَ، فَسَأَلُوا رَسُولَ اللهِ صَلَّى الله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 فَقَالَ: " مَا عَلَيْكُمْ أَنْ لَا تَفْعَلُوا، فَإِنَّ اللهَ عَزَّ وَجَلَّ قَدْ كَتَبَ مَنْ هُوَ خَالِقٌ إِلَى يَوْمِ الْقِيَامَةِ " (١)،

Translation

English translation

It is narrated from Abu Saeed Khudri (may Allah be pleased with him) that we set out with the Prophet (peace and blessings of Allah be upon him) on the occasion of the Battle of Banu Mustaliq. We obtained captives, we had desire for women, and loneliness was very hard upon us, and we wished to ransom them for a price. Therefore, we asked the Prophet (peace and blessings of Allah be upon him) about withdrawal (coitus interruptus). The Prophet (peace and blessings of Allah be upon him) said: If you do not do so, it will not make any difference; every soul that is to come until the Day of Resurrection will come.
